Liverpool v Swansea ratings: Klavan & Lovren dire; Carroll great
Ragnar Klavan was the worst player on the pitch as Liverpool’s defence crumbled in the second half of a 3-2 loss to Swansea at Anfield.
Liverpool ratings
Simon Mignolet: Little to do apart from the three goals but hard to blame the Belgium for any of them. Might have done better to set himself for Swansea’s second. 5
Nathaniel Clyne: Failed to close down Martin Olsson quick enough before Olsson fed Tom Carroll for Fernando Llorente’s second goal. The usually reliable Clyne had a game to forget as he was out of position on a few occasions and offered very little going forward. 4
Ragnar Klavan: Catastrophic display. Lost Llorente for his second goal although it was a superb header from the Spaniard. Might have been lucky to stay on the pitch after Kevin Friend decided not to give him a second yellow for a challenge on Llorente. Weak clearance into the path of Glyfi Sigurdsson for the midfielder to score Swansea’s third. 3
Dejan Lovren: Failed to win a header against Fernandez that led to Swansea’s opener. Better in the opposition’s box than defending in his own. 5
James Milner: Lovely ball from the left for Roberto Firmino’s goal. Provided much-needed attacking spark on the left. Can’t be blamed solely for any of the goals, although he was part of a defense that conceded three. 6
Georginio Wijnaldum: Made a lovely run for Liverpool’s second goal before knocking it round one player and setting up Firmino with a wonderful cross. Needs to improve final ball. 6
Jordan Henderson: Really poor passing in the first half from the 26-year-old, however he recovered in the last half an hour to keep Liverpool’s attacks ticking over. Guilty of a silly foul late on. 5
Emre Can: Really poor performance from the German. Wasted a couple of chances, mis-placed passes galore and failed to close down Swansea players fast enough. Taken off with 20 minutes to go. 4
Adam Lallana: Could have done better in the first half with a chance created by Roberto Firmino, only to send his acrobatic kick miles over the bar. A lot of the Reds’ good play in the second half went through Lallana. 6
Roberto Firmino: Played far too narrow in the first half. Took his first goal well with a fantastic header at the back post. His second was simply exquisute – incredible chest control and volley into the bottom left-hand corner. 8
Philippe Coutinho: Showed his usual class with some nice touches and intelligent play, but was forced too deep at times. Taken off to give Liverpool more bite up top. 6
Substitutes
Daniel Sturridge (came on for Coutinho 57′) Stayed on the last man’s shoulder and offered very little. Decent pull-back for Lallana late on. 5
Divock Origi (came on for Can 70′) Went more direct when the Belgian striker came on but had minimal impact. One shot and turned easily saved. 6
Joel Matip (came on for Wijnaldum 90+4′) Came on up front. Little time to influence the match. 5
